3. Seafile
Seafile is a leading open-source cloud storage service for businesses. With Seafile, you can store and share files securely in the cloud, collaborate with teammates, and stay organized with ease. Seafile offers several features perfect for businesses, including file syncing, data encryption, and more.
Features:
- File Syncing: Reliable and efficient file syncing to any device to improve your productivity.
- Drive Client: Seafile extends the local disk space with the massive storage capacity on the server. You can also access your files offline.
- Built-in File Encryption: The user encrypts files before syncing to the server. Even admins can’t access them.
- Enterprise Ready: Features built with enterprise environments: AD/LDAP integration, group syncing, department hierarchy, and fine-grained permission control.
Seafile offers a professional license for you to access all the features. The cost ranges from free (for three users) to USD 35/user (for 750 to 999 users). For large companies with more than 1000+ users, you can contact them to get further details on the pricing.

1. Sync
Sync is a cloud storage service that offers end-to-end encryption. It encrypts all files before they are uploaded to the cloud, which prevents any third party from accessing them. Only the user who holds the encryption key can access and decrypt the files.
Sync offers a secure and convenient way to store files in the cloud. Therefore, it is ideal for users who are concerned about their data security and need a safe and reliable storage solution.
Features:
- Enterprise-grade infrastructure and certified with top security and privacy regulations
- Back up your data and recover them from ransomware, hardware failure, or human error
- Manage permissions to keep your work protected at all times

2. SpiderOak ONE
SpiderOak ONE is a cloud storage service known for its security features. The service offers end-to-end encryption, which means that your data is encrypted before being uploaded to the cloud and can only be decrypted by you. As a result, no one can access your data, even if they were to hack into the cloud storage service.
Features:
- End-to-end encryption and no-knowledge policy, so SpiderOak ONE doesn’t have access to your data and can’t see what is being stored.
- Background cloud backup to protect your files from data loss & ransomware.
- SpiderOak ONE Share Rooms, a one-way secure sharing where you can set up passwords to your folders and share with anyone
